About the event

Chloe Lydell, an OU alumna and civil litigation lawyer with Staffordshire & West Midlands Police, joins the OULS as a guest speaker.


​Chloe graduated from the Open University with a First-Class Bachelor of Laws (LLB Hons) in 2023, before beginnin​g her role as a Graduate Solicitor Apprentice in September 2023. Alongside practice, ​she completed the Graduate Diploma in Legal Practice and the SQE at BPP​ passing both SQE1 and SQE2 in the top quintile on ​her first attempt. ​She qualified as a solicitor and was admitted to the Roll ​in March 2026. 


T​he session will focus on Chloe's route to qualification and her experience followed by a Q&A giving you the chance to ask Chloe questions about the SQE; a solicitor apprenticeship and a day in the life of a practising solicitor.
